Summary
The chapter explores the turmoil within the Qing Xuan Sanctuary during a time of crisis, as rumors spread among the disciples, undermining morale. Xia Zheng Yuan, the Grand Overseer, confronts and punishes several inner disciples for their cowardice and treachery, using harsh methods to restore order. Despite his efforts, he realizes that the sect's supposed invincibility is an illusion, as the disciples display cowardice in the face of real danger. The chapter also introduces discussions among the elders about Gu Xiu, a former disciple who may be their only hope against the Red Robe Army. Ge Ling Long decides to send a message to Gu Xiu, hoping he will return to aid the sect, while the elders remain wary of the true origins of the Red Robe threat.
